Bhubaneswar: Gandharva Kala Parishad, one of Odisha’s premier institutions in the performing and visual arts, is all set to roll out the red carpet for its Golden Jubilee celebrations.

The much-anticipated Dr Dibakar Mishra Gandharva Kala Festival 2025 will be held on June 21 and 22 at Rabindra Mandap from 6.30 pm onwards, promising a feast for the senses.

Founded in 1974 by the visionary Dr Dibakar Mishra, the institution has grown from strength to strength, now boasting 30 branches across Odisha. It continues to be a cradle of creativity, nurturing talents in Odissi dance, music, acting, literature, and fine arts.

Currently steered by Guru Smt Gayatri Mishra, daughter of the founder, the Parishad has left an indelible mark on the cultural map of India.

This year’s festival is particularly special, as the Parishad not only celebrates 50 glorious years but also honours four stalwarts with Lifetime Achievement Awards for their towering contributions to their respective fields.

They are Padma Shri Shilpiguru Dr Chaturbhuj Meher for Visual Art, Dr Soubhagya Kumar Mishra for Literature, Padma Shri Guru Durga Charan Ranbir for Odissi Dance and Sabyasachi Mohapatra for Film Direction.

The two-day cultural bonanza is packed to the brim with performances by some of the finest artistes in the field.

On the opening evening, audiences will be treated to solo Odissi recitals by Dr Pompi Paul and Smt Pranati Mohanty, a duet by Dr Noor Raza and Tithibhadra Mohapatra, group presentations by Nritya Naivedya and the Gandharva Kala Parishad dancers.

The curtain will fall in style on the second evening with a soul-stirring solo Odissi vocal recital by Guru Smt Sangita Panda, Odissi dance solos by Guru Smt Gayatri Mishra and Guru Gourishankar Dash and a captivating duet by Dr Anisha Anukampa and Ms Prachi Mishra.

Over the years, students of Gandharva Kala Parishad have not only made their mark as Doordarshan and AIR artistes, but also brought home laurels from reputed festivals both within and beyond Odisha.
